Pantani Throwback: Bianchi MegaPro XL

Despite carbon having been on the scene for more than a decade in when Marco Pantani became the last rider to win both the Giro d’Italia and Tour de France, he chose to ride alloy. His Bianchi MegaPro XL was made with Dedacciai thin-wall alloy tubing, which was then given a shot-pin surface treatment to toughen the super-thin tube walls. The bike’s name, MegaPro XL, comes from the name of the down-tube design. Created in Bianchi’s legendary Reparto Corse [“race department”], the alloy down tube was round at the head tube, widened in the middle and then became elliptical at the bottom bracket.

The MegaPro XL represented the state of the art in alloy at the turn of the millennium. Pantani’s frame weighed just pounds (1, grams), just grams more than the ultralight carbon Specialissima. There were two versions of the Mega Pro, an L, and the top of the range XL that Pantani and his Mercatone Uno teammates rode.

Bianchi released Marco Pantani edition “Specialissima”, a special bike to celebrate the 20th anniversary of Marco Pantani’s Giro-Tour double. The bike has the iconic celeste-yellow fade paint job, the same color schema of Marco Pantani’s Bianchi. In , after winning the Giro d’Italia, Pantani rode the yellow and celeste Bianchi Mega Pro XL (serial number H ) in the famous July 27 Grenoble-Le Duex Alpes stage of the Tour de France. He attacked Jan Ullrich on the Galibier climb and won the stage, taking the race lead. He went on to win the Tour in Paris ahead of 2nd finisher Ullrich and 3rd Bobby Julich.

This was a feat only achieved by seven riders in history: Fausto Coppi (, ), Jacques Anquetil (), Eddy Merckx (, , ), Bernard Hinault (, ), Stephen Roche (), Miguel Indurain (, ) and Marco Pantani ().

There is an important difference between the two bikes: Pantani’s Mega Pro XL was made with light aluminum, but the new Specialissima is full carbon. The frame, which also features Bianchi’s “Countervail” vibration canceling technology, is only grams.
